Who funds Beechwood Home?
Beechwood Home is funded by 40 grantmakers, led by The Beechwood Foundation ($13.7M), Nellie Agnew Bechtel Trust ($1.2M), The Oliver Family Foundation ($1.0M). In total, IRS Form 990 filings record $18.4M in grants to Beechwood Home between 2019–2025.
